On 3 december 1984, over 500,000 people in the vicinity of the union carbide india limited pesticide plant in bhopal, madhya pradesh, india were exposed to the highly toxic gas methyl isocyanate, in what is considered the world's worst industrial disaster The facility, which manufactured pesticides, was home to large quantities of methyl isocyanate (mic), a highly toxic chemical. [3] a government affidavit in 2006 stated that the leak caused approximately 558,125 injuries, including 38,478 temporary partial injuries.

What was the bhopal disaster On the night of december 2, 1984, a series of events led to a catastrophic gas leak at the ucil plant in bhopal The bhopal disaster was a chemical leak that occurred on december 3, 1984, in the indian city of bhopal
It killed an estimated 15,000 to 20,000 people
At the time, it was the worst industrial accident in history.
